Transaction 5065632c36b06f2f42104b648ceefa51fe99fbace6a426443603112b1765dc42

1 Input
2 Outputs
  • 5065632c36b06f2f42104b648ceefa51fe99fbace6a426443603112b1765dc42:0
  • value  14593841
    address  3C2ZPbx8FU3xqRasYoQN1jptMUMQUGZ316
  • 5065632c36b06f2f42104b648ceefa51fe99fbace6a426443603112b1765dc42:1
  • value  27060
    address  1KaMYcKpBVRzfJ2zsieku636YiURsf2oRu